Exploring the Difference Between Web Development and App Development
Hey there, tech enthusiasts! So, you've heard about web development and app development, but you're not quite sure what sets them apart? Don't worry, I'll break it down for you in simple terms!
First things first, what exactly is web development? Well, think of it like building a house on the internet! Web development involves creating websites or web applications that can be accessed through a web browser, like Google Chrome or Safari. It's all about designing, building, and maintaining websites that people can visit and interact with online.
Now, let's talk about app development. This is like building a cozy little home on your smartphone or tablet! App development involves creating mobile applications that are installed directly onto your device, like games, social media apps, or productivity tools. It's all about designing, building, and maintaining applications that people can download and use on their mobile devices.
So, what's the difference between web development and app development? Here are a few key distinctions:
Platform: The biggest difference between web development and app development is the platform they're built for. Web app development services focuses on creating websites or web applications that are accessed through a web browser on desktop computers or mobile devices. App development, on the other hand, focuses on creating mobile applications that are installed directly onto a device and accessed through an icon on the home screen.
Technology: Web development typically involves technologies like HTML, CSS, and JavaScript for creating the front end (what users see and interact with) and languages like PHP, Python, or Node.js for creating the back end (the server-side logic). App development, on the other hand, often involves languages like Java or Kotlin for Android development, Swift or Objective-C for iOS development, or frameworks like React Native or Flutter for cross-platform development.
Distribution: Web applications are usually accessible to anyone with an internet connection and can be accessed through a web browser without the need for installation. Mobile applications, on the other hand, need to be downloaded and installed onto a device from an app store like the Apple App Store or Google Play Store.
User Experience: The user experience of web applications and mobile applications can be quite different. Web applications are designed to work across different devices and screen sizes, so they often have a responsive design that adapts to fit the user's device. Mobile applications, on the other hand, are specifically designed for use on mobile devices and can take advantage of features like touch screens, GPS, and push notifications.
In conclusion, while web development and app development share some similarities, such as creating digital experiences for users, they also have key differences in terms of platform, technology, distribution, and user experience. Whether you're interested in building websites or mobile applications, both fields offer exciting opportunities to unleash your creativity and make an impact in the digital world!

Factors Affecting the Development Cost
Several variables influence the overall cost of building a Zalando-style eCommerce app in 2025:
1. App Complexity
The number and type of features you want to include will significantly affect cost. A basic app with essential shopping features is more affordable than one with AI-driven recommendations and AR-based virtual try-ons.
2. Platform Choice
Developing for Android, iOS, and Web simultaneously will increase cost. Cross-platform frameworks like Flutter can save time and money.
3. Design Requirements
Custom UI/UX designs tailored for your brand elevate the user experience but can add to development hours and costs.
4. Development Team Location
Outsourcing development to countries like India or Eastern Europe is more budget-friendly compared to hiring agencies in the US or UK.
5. Third-Party Integrations
Payment gateways, shipping APIs, CRM tools, and analytics tools often require additional configuration and licensing fees.
6. Testing and QA
To ensure bug-free performance across all devices, comprehensive testing is essential. It adds cost but saves money long-term by reducing post-launch issues.
Cost Breakdown of Zalando-Like App Development in 2025
Here’s a rough estimate of what each component might cost:
Development Component Estimated Cost (USD)
UI/UX Design $5,000 – $10,000
Mobile App (Android & iOS) $20,000 – $40,000
Web App $10,000 – $20,000
Backend Development $15,000 – $30,000
Admin Dashboard $5,000 – $10,000
Advanced Features (AI, AR, etc.) $10,000 – $25,000
Testing & QA $5,000 – $8,000
Maintenance (Annual) $5,000 – $10,000
Total Cost $70,000 – $150,000+
Keep in mind, if you start with an MVP (Minimum Viable Product), you could reduce your initial budget by 40–50%, focusing only on core features.

Key Factors Influencing Dating App Development Cost
The cost to develop a dating app depends on a variety of factors, including the app's complexity, the choice of platform, and the development team's location. Here are the primary elements that contribute to the cost breakdown:
Essential Features and Their Impact on Cost
The first thing to consider when developing a dating app is which features are essential. A basic dating app will require functionalities like user registration, profile creation, matching algorithms, and messaging. More advanced features, like live video chats, geolocation, AI-based matchmaking, and in-app purchases, will increase both the complexity and dating app development cost.
For example, adding premium features for monetization such as subscriptions, user verification, or a "boost" feature for profiles will further increase the overall cost. A professional dating app development company can help you prioritize these features to align with your budget.
UI/UX Design: User Experience Matters
The design of your app plays a significant role in user engagement. A clean, user-friendly interface will increase user retention, making it a vital part of your dating app’s success. While custom UI/UX design can add to the dating app development cost, the investment pays off with improved user satisfaction. Opting for a simple design can reduce costs, but a unique and engaging experience is key to attracting and keeping users.
Tech Stack and Backend Architecture
The technology stack is another major factor that influences the cost of dating app development. The backend infrastructure is crucial for smooth functionality, supporting user profiles, geolocation services, messaging, and matching algorithms. Technologies such as Node.js, Firebase, or Python are common choices for dating app backends.
Choosing a scalable, secure, and reliable backend architecture ensures that your app can grow as your user base expands. A skilled dating app development company can help you choose the right stack and manage costs effectively by using open-source technologies and cloud services to reduce initial investments.
Platform Choice: Android, iOS, or Both?
Another factor that impacts the dating app development cost is whether you choose to develop for Android, iOS, or both. Native development for each platform requires separate teams and additional time, increasing the overall cost. Cross-platform development using frameworks like Flutter or React Native offers a cost-effective solution, but it may come with certain limitations in terms of app performance.
A dating app development company can guide you on the best platform choices based on your target audience and budget. For startups, cross-platform development may be the most efficient way to manage both time and costs.
Development Team Location and Expertise
The location of your development team can drastically influence costs. Development teams in North America or Western Europe tend to charge higher rates ($100–$200 per hour). However, partnering with an experienced dating app development company in regions like India or Eastern Europe can provide you with high-quality developers at a more affordable rate, typically ranging from $25–$50 per hour.
The right team will have experience building dating apps, ensuring that both functionality and user experience meet your expectations while keeping within your budget.
Estimating the Dating App Development Cost
The cost to develop a dating app varies significantly depending on the features, platform, design complexity, and backend. Below is a rough estimate:
Basic App (MVP): $15,000 to $30,000 — Includes basic features like profile creation, matching, and messaging.
Medium Complexity App: $40,000 to $70,000 — Adds features like geolocation, real-time chat, and in-app purchases.
Advanced App with AI & Video Features: $80,000 to $150,000+ — Includes complex features like AI-based matchmaking, live video chat, and subscription models.
Remember that these are just ballpark figures. The dating app development cost will depend on specific requirements and the complexity of your app.
Hidden Costs to Keep in Mind
Beyond development, there are ongoing costs that should be accounted for in your budget. These can include server hosting, cloud storage, third-party API integration, marketing, customer support, and maintenance. It's important to plan for these ongoing expenses to ensure the longevity and success of your app.

Python App Development Guide [2025]: Build Powerful Applications
Python is the third most popular programming language in 2025, especially for novice programmers and small business owners, and is known for its simplicity, versatility, and focus on code readability.
Python for app development allows developers to create scalable and efficient applications with minimal effort.

Why is Python So Popular for App Development?
Here are 8 key aspects of the popularity of Python for mobile app development.
1- Ease of Learning and Readability:
Python is often praised for its simple and readable syntax. Its code is easy to understand and write, making it an excellent choice for beginners and experienced developers. This ease of learning accelerates the development process and reduces the likelihood of errors.
2- Extensive Libraries and Frameworks:
It has a vast standard library that includes modules and packages for various functionalities. Additionally, numerous third-party libraries and frameworks simplify and speed up development. Popular frameworks such as Django and Flask are widely used for web development, while Kivy is popular for creating cross-platform mobile applications.
3- Versatility of Python App Development:
Python is a general-purpose programming language, making it versatile for different types of app development. Whether you’re working on web development, data analysis, machine learning, or artificial intelligence, Python has tools and Python libraries available to support your project.
4- Community Support:
Python has a large and active community of developers. This community support means that you can find solutions to problems, access documentation, and seek help easily. The collaborative nature of the Python community contributes to the language’s continuous improvement.
5- Cross-Platform Compatibility:
Python is a cross-platform language, meaning that applications developed in Python can run on various operating systems with minimal modifications. This flexibility is particularly beneficial for projects targeting multiple platforms such as Windows, macOS, and Linux.
Using Python for mobile app development involves several steps, and the approach can vary based on the type of application you want to build (web, mobile, desktop, etc.).
Below is a general guide on how to use Python for mobile app development:
Choose the Type of App
Web Development: For web applications, popular frameworks like Django and Flask are commonly used. Django is a high-level web framework that follows the Model-View-Controller (MVC) pattern, while Flask is a microframework that provides more flexibility.
# Example: Installing Django
pip install django
# Example: Creating a new Django project
django-admin startproject projectname
# Example: Running the development server
python manage.py runserver
Mobile Development: For mobile app development with Python, you can use frameworks like Kivy, BeeWare’s Toga, or tools like KivyMD (for material design).
These Python mobile development frameworks allow you to write Python code and deploy it to Android and iOS.
# Example: Installing Kivy
pip install kivy
# Example: Creating a basic Kivy app
python -m pip install kivy
Desktop Development: For desktop applications, frameworks like PyQt or Tkinter are commonly used. PyQt is a set of Python bindings for the Qt application framework, and Tkinter is the standard GUI toolkit included with Python.
# Example: Installing PyQt
pip install PyQt5
# Example: Creating a basic PyQt app
Below are the Simple Steps for Python App Development
Set Up the Development Environment: Install a code editor or Integrated Development Environment (IDE) suitable for Python development, such as VSCode, PyCharm, or Atom.
Learn the Basics of Python: If you’re new to Python, it’s essential to familiarize yourself with the basics of the language. Understand data types, control structures, functions, and object-oriented programming concepts.
Explore Framework Documentation: Depending on the framework you choose, explore the official documentation to understand its features, components, and best practices.
Write Code: Start writing the code for your application. Follow the structure and conventions of the chosen framework.
Test Your App: Write unit tests to ensure the functionality of your application. Use testing frameworks like unittest or pytest.
# Example: Installing pytest
pip install pytest
# Example: Running tests with pytest
pytest
Optimize and Debug: Optimize your code for performance and resolve any bugs or issues. Use debugging tools provided by your IDE or use print statements to troubleshoot.
Package and Distribute: Depending on the type of application, use tools like PyInstaller or cx_Freeze to package your application into executables for distribution.
# Example: Installing pyinstaller
pip install pyinstaller
# Example: Creating an executable with pyinstaller
pyinstaller your_script.py
Deploy: Deploy your application on the desired platform. For web applications, you might need to set up a server. For mobile apps, you can distribute them through app stores, and for desktop apps, users can download and install the executable.
Maintain and Update: Regularly maintain and update your application based on user feedback, feature requests, and bug reports. Remember that Python is a versatile language, and the specific steps may vary depending on the type of application and the chosen framework. Always refer to the official documentation for the tools and frameworks you are using.

In-memory caching frameworks are an essential part of modern web application development. They allow developers to improve the performance of their applications by storing frequently accessed data in memory, reducing the need for expensive database queries. In-memory caching frameworks are used for a variety of purposes such as improving response times, reducing server load, and scaling applications. In this article, we have discussed ten popular in-memory caching frameworks used in web application development. We have covered both commercial and open-source solutions, with a focus on their features, capabilities, and use cases. By the end of this article, you will have a good understanding of the different in-memory caching frameworks available and be able to choose the one that best suits your application's needs. Redis Redis is an open-source, in-memory data structure store that is used as a database, cache, and message broker. Redis supports a wide range of data structures such as strings, hashes, lists, sets, sorted sets with range queries, bitmaps, hyperloglogs, and geospatial indexes with radius queries. Redis is highly scalable and has a high-performance, low-latency design, making it a popular choice for caching and data processing applications. Redis also supports a variety of programming languages including Java, Python, C#, and Node.js, making it a versatile choice for developers. Memcached Memcached is a high-performance, distributed memory object caching system that is used to speed up dynamic web applications. Memcached stores data in RAM and serves requests from memory, which makes it faster than traditional disk-based storage systems. Memcached is designed to be simple, fast, and scalable. It supports a variety of programming languages including C, C++, Java, Perl, Python, Ruby, and PHP. Memcached is used by many popular websites such as Facebook, Twitter, and YouTube to improve the performance of their web applications. Hazelcast Hazelcast is a distributed in-memory data grid that is used for scaling web applications and caching data. Hazelcast provides a distributed data structure, allowing data to be cached across multiple nodes, and supports distributed computing frameworks such as MapReduce, ExecutorService, and ForkJoinPool. Hazelcast is compatible with a wide range of programming languages including Java, C++, .NET, and Python, making it a versatile choice for developers. Hazelcast provides advanced features such as data partitioning, data replication, distributed locking, and distributed transactions. It is commonly used for caching data, session management, and distributed computing. Apache Ignite Apache Ignite is an in-memory computing platform that is used for distributed computing, data processing, and caching. Apache Ignite provides a distributed key-value store, allowing data to be cached across multiple nodes, and supports distributed SQL and distributed computing frameworks such as MapReduce and Spark. Apache Ignite is designed to be highly scalable, fault-tolerant, and low-latency. It supports a wide range of programming languages including Java, .NET, C++, and Python, and can be deployed in a variety of environments such as on-premise, cloud, and hybrid. Apache Ignite is commonly used for caching data, real-time analytics, and high-performance computing. Couchbase Couchbase is a NoSQL document database with built-in caching capabilities that is used for high-performance, scalable web applications. Couchbase provides an in-memory caching layer that stores frequently accessed data in RAM for faster access. Couchbase also provides advanced features such as data partitioning, data replication, and cross-datacenter replication. Couchbase supports a wide range of programming languages including Java, .NET, Node.js, Python, and Ruby, making it a versatile choice for developers. Couchbase is commonly used for caching data, real-time analytics, and high-performance computing.
Aerospike Aerospike is a high-performance, distributed NoSQL database with in-memory caching capabilities that is used for real-time applications. Aerospike provides a distributed key-value store that allows data to be cached across multiple nodes, and supports distributed computing frameworks such as MapReduce and Spark. Aerospike is designed to be highly scalable, fault-tolerant, and low-latency. It supports a wide range of programming languages including Java, .NET, C++, and Python, and can be deployed in a variety of environments such as on-premise, cloud, and hybrid. Aerospike provides advanced features such as data replication, data partitioning, and automatic data migration. It is commonly used for caching data, session management, and real-time analytics. GridGain GridGain is an in-memory computing platform that is used for distributed computing, data processing, and caching. GridGain provides a distributed key-value store that allows data to be cached across multiple nodes, and supports distributed computing frameworks such as MapReduce, Spark, and Storm. GridGain is designed to be highly scalable, fault-tolerant, and low-latency. It supports a wide range of programming languages including Java, .NET, C++, and Python, and can be deployed in a variety of environments such as on-premise, cloud, and hybrid. GridGain provides advanced features such as data replication, data partitioning, and automatic data migration. It is commonly used for caching data, real-time analytics, and high-performance computing. Oracle Coherence Oracle Coherence is an in-memory data grid that is used for distributed caching, data processing, and real-time analytics. Oracle Coherence provides a distributed key-value store that allows data to be cached across multiple nodes, and supports distributed computing frameworks such as MapReduce and Spark. Oracle Coherence is designed to be highly scalable, fault-tolerant, and low-latency. It supports a wide range of programming languages including Java, .NET, and C++, and can be deployed in a variety of environments such as on-premise, cloud, and hybrid. Oracle Coherence provides advanced features such as data partitioning, data replication, and distributed locking. It is commonly used for caching data, session management, and real-time analytics. Ehcache Ehcache is an open-source, Java-based, in-memory caching library that is used for caching data in Java applications. Ehcache provides a simple, lightweight caching solution that can be easily integrated into Java applications. Ehcache supports a variety of caching strategies such as time-based expiration, least recently used (LRU) eviction, and first in, first out (FIFO) eviction. Ehcache is designed to be highly scalable and supports distributed caching through its Terracotta add-on. Ehcache also supports a variety of Java frameworks such as Hibernate, Spring, and Struts, making it a popular choice for Java developers. Caffeine Caffeine is an open-source, Java-based, high-performance, in-memory caching library that is used for caching data in Java applications. Caffeine provides a simple, lightweight caching solution that can be easily integrated into Java applications. Caffeine supports a variety of caching strategies such as time-based expiration, least recently used (LRU) eviction, and first in, first out (FIFO) eviction. Caffeine is designed to be highly scalable and supports both single and multiple JVM (Java Virtual Machine) caching. Caffeine provides advanced features such as automatic cache population, asynchronous loading, and refresh-ahead caching. Caffeine is a popular choice for Java developers due to its high performance and low overhead. In-memory caching frameworks are a critical component of modern web application development. They enable developers to improve application performance, reduce server load, and scale applications. There are many in-memory caching frameworks available, both commercial and open-source, each with its own unique features and capabilities.
The choice of framework depends on the specific requirements of the application, including performance, scalability, and reliability. By understanding the different in-memory caching frameworks available, developers can make informed decisions and choose the best framework for their application's needs.
